Steampunk Spotlight: SPC Readers’ Choice Awards
The Steampunk Chronicle (SPC) is currently taking nominations for the best in Steampunk!
Go to their website to nominate through February 26. Voting starts on March 5 and runs through April 3rd. Winners will be announced as part of STEAMFest in Atlanta, GA.
You will need to create an account and login to nominate because SPAM, unfortunately, is a reality. Have mercy…your Steampunk entertainers and The Steampunk Chronicle are worth the few extra moments to do so.
